Geocache Description:

This is a tribute cache dedicated to Lotus Land Cacher and the Dr. Sigmund Fraud Cache Shrink series. As with the originals, this cache is a recycled drug container with just a log sheet and pencil inside, but I would suggest you bring a writing implement with you just in case. Alas, I had no grey duct tape, only camo style.

Affliction: Geo-Blitz Saturation Syndrome

Symptoms: during Blitz, feels an uncontrollable urge to place a seemingly never-ending series of caches 162 metres apart alongside a system of popular hiking trails.

I hope you enjoy your trek around Burnaby Lake as much as I did and you get a bit of a chuckle out of this cache. Good luck!

FTF is welcome to help themselves to the small statue that is in the container. I put him in there because I thought he looks a bit like Siggy.
